Output 30db8fbe1b3096f2cd21d3ec246e542616de236d411ba5eab8be0c94fef13d86:1

value
127187803
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bb2e3598eecc8eef03a5c45687cefb1ce7d259a OP_EQUAL
address
38bGuHxFe9hmx7rCyb7VrUpQK6KCWdz4eA
transaction
30db8fbe1b3096f2cd21d3ec246e542616de236d411ba5eab8be0c94fef13d86
spent
true